Software notes The AtomStack Swift supports the most widely used laser control software, including LaserGRBL (free, Windows only) and LightBurn (paid, compatible with Windows, macOS, and Linux). It connects via USB or Wi-Fi, providing excellent flexibility for sending g-code files directly to the machine. This machine offers complete compatibility with the main control software currently available for diode lasers, thanks to the adoption of the 32-bit GRBL standard protocol and firmware. Users can manage engraving operations using established and well-documented programs such as LightBurn (paid software, ideal for advanced workflows and users of all operational levels) and LaserGRBL (free and open-source, perfect for those operating on Windows systems). The connection typically occurs via a standard USB cable, ensuring stable communication between the host computer and the machine's motherboard while executing the generated toolpath. The use of closed proprietary software is not required, thus offering maximum operational flexibility.
